Hi Makman,

(My english is very poor.... so plz don't mind errors etc...)

Thank you so much 4 your fantastic mod, it work fine and well on my PC, the only "issue" (but is not very important... I'm just curious) is about the visual undewater, the seafloor don't have a fade out as show in the picture, it ends in a straight line.

Iit is normal? (or I assume is a limitation of the SH3 engine).

Thanks in advance.







hello TOY,

thank you too for your kind words

about your question: i don't 'see' underwater the same thing with you with MEP v5 installed. the following pics are showing the underwater vissibility in the navigation training mission with MEP v5:







my thought is that maybe is 3d driver or graphic cards theme (but i am totally noob on these themes for helping further).
the values that are responsible for the underwater fog fading are located in scene.dat at EnvSim>FogDistances>UnderwaterObjectsRelativeZMin and UnderwaterObjectsRelativeZMax
so try changing (increasing or decreasing) these values there to see if it is getting any better for you
